Beyond Shelf Life: Nutritional Integrity Preservation

When we think of food preservation, we often focus solely on extending shelf life. However, mixed tocopherols offer much more than just longevity. These natural compounds, derived from vegetable oils, are potent antioxidants that protect food from oxidation, rancidity, and spoilage.

But what sets mixed tocopherols apart is their ability to preserve the nutritional value of food. Unlike synthetic preservatives that may compromise the food's nutritional profile, mixed tocopherols work harmoniously with the food's natural components. They shield essential vitamins, minerals, and beneficial compounds from degradation, ensuring that the food remains not just edible, but nutritious over time.

The preservation mechanism of mixed tocopherols is truly remarkable. These compounds act as molecular bodyguards, neutralizing free radicals that would otherwise damage food molecules. By donating electrons to these unstable molecules, tocopherols prevent a chain reaction of oxidation that can lead to food spoilage and nutrient loss.

Moreover, mixed tocopherols exhibit synergistic effects. The different forms of tocopherols (alpha, beta, gamma, and delta) work together, each bringing unique properties to the table. This synergy results in a more comprehensive and effective preservation strategy compared to using a single form of tocopherol.

Another fascinating aspect of mixed tocopherols and mixed tocopherol concentrate is their role in maintaining food texture and flavor. By preventing oxidation of fats and oils, they help preserve the sensory qualities of food. This means that not only does the food stay fresh longer, but it also retains its original taste, aroma, and mouthfeel - a crucial factor in consumer satisfaction.

FAQ

1. What is the recommended dosage for mixed tocopherol concentrate in food preservation?

The optimal dosage of mixed tocopherol concentrate can vary depending on the specific food product, its composition, and desired shelf life. Generally, it ranges from 0.02% to 0.05% of the total product weight. However, it's crucial to consult with experts or conduct trials to determine the most effective concentration for your specific application.

2. Are mixed tocopherols suitable for all types of food products?

While mixed tocopherols are versatile and can be used in a wide range of food products, they are particularly effective in preserving foods with high fat content. This includes oils, nuts, baked goods, and meat products. However, their applicability may be limited in water-based products or those with very low fat content.

3. How do mixed tocopherols compare to synthetic antioxidants in terms of efficacy?

Mixed tocopherols have shown comparable or superior efficacy to many synthetic antioxidants in preserving food quality and extending shelf life. They offer the added advantage of being natural and potentially contributing to the nutritional value of the food. However, the exact comparison can depend on the specific food matrix and storage conditions.

4. Can mixed tocopherols be used in organic food products?

Yes, mixed tocopherols derived from natural sources are generally accepted for use in organic food products. However, it's important to verify with relevant organic certification bodies, as regulations can vary between different countries and certifying organizations.
